Exposing to the Right Explained

What do we mean when we suggest that you “expose to the right”? In literal terms, this phrase refers to the histogram, a chart that shows us the spread of detail in our image from the darkest to brightest values. For a shot to be well exposed, or neutral, we are trained to aim for an even spread of data across the chart. When exposing to the right, the idea is to slightly overexpose the image, moving more of that data to the right of the chart. The resulting image will contain more detail and have less visible noise.

Exposing to the Right
The left histogram shows a neutral exposure, where the right shows an image exposed to the right.

This practice is primarily designed to deliver the best possible image quality by preserving shadow detail without blowing out highlights. Sometimes that means taking an image that is slightly brighter than your camera’s built-in meter suggests, which is why it’s hard to accomplish shooting in automatic mode. This is essential, as the meter is how a camera evaluates the available light to determine the right settings to create a neutral exposure, which is not always the best exposure.

A neutral exposure is one that is as close to a neutral gray or 18% middle gray. This is the level of brightness meters are calibrated to though it is not always perfect. For instance, when photographing something bright white like snow, we want to capture it as we see it. If we rely solely on our meter, the snow will appear as a drab, middle gray. Far from the wintry wonderland we aim to capture.

Put It to Practice

The biggest challenge of exposing to the right is not taking things too far. As we mentioned in the intro, this technique can ruin our shots if we’re not careful. For instance, if we severely overexpose our image, we run the risk of blowing out our highlights. The result is a highlight that is completely white and lacks any data whatsoever.

One helpful tool to aid us in nailing our exposures is the aforementioned histogram. If you do any post-processing, you’ve likely seen this chart on your screen at one time or another, but it can also be viewed right in camera, either on the rear LCD after the photo has been taken, or in live view while you’re actively shooting.

Histogram Different Exposures

Note that the histogram that you see on your camera is not as sophisticated as it may appear. Whether you’re shooting in JPEG or RAW formats, the camera will always show you the data for the processed JPEG. If you’re shooting RAW, this important to remember, as the camera may indicate that your image is slightly over exposed while there’s still data to work with in post. Don’t delete any image in camera without first checking it on the computer.

Manual Exposure

Through the trials and tribulations of mastering exposure, the case for manual exposure becomes ever clear. In auto, the meter is in full control, meaning that the camera will only capture those dull, neutral exposures. We need to have some input into this equation, and shooting manual does just that. In fact, it does more, it puts us in complete control.

Shooting manually allows the photographer to individually dial in settings as the scene and artistic intent demand. Mirrorless cameras have made this even easier, as we can now see our exposures before we even press the shutter button. Many of these cameras even allow you to have the histogram visible in the viewfinder to make the process much easier.

Even DSLR users can have the histogram up in live view, or they can see it in image review. No matter which camera type we use, this concept remains the same. As we’re learning, we can take a shot, then analyze the histogram in camera. If it’s just barely overexposed, we’re good to go.

Auto ISO with Exposure Compensation

A less hands-on approach would be shooting in manual or a program mode like shutter or aperture priority with Auto-ISO activated and exposure compensation dialed in. This puts some of the controls back into the hands of the camera, while keeping one hand on the wheel.

When you adjust your exposure compensation, it’ll be indicated above the meter like the example above.

With exposure compensation, we can nudge the meter in the direction we want by telling the camera to overexpose the scene in third stop increments. This way, we can get the results we want without having to worry about changing specific settings.

Exposure Warning/Zebras

Exposure warnings are a visual indication that shows blown out highlights or shadows. Traditionally, this feature is only available when reviewing an image as you would to analyze the histogram. This offered a more complete overview, not only telling you that some values were over or underexposed but showing you specifically where.

Sony and OM System users have access to a live warning system often called “blankies.” In the Sony system they’re called zebras. This can be activated in the menu and set specifically to +109 as the tolerance. Once dialed in, highlights will appear with the black and white striped pattern. As you adjust your settings, only stop when you see the zebra pattern. Once visible, lower your exposure only enough to no longer see the zebra pattern.

Posting Processing

Before you ask, no, we’re not suggesting that you fix it in post. Getting your exposure perfect, or as close to perfect as possible, is nearly impossible. There are always a few odds and ends that we touch up in the edit which don’t alter the overall image. We refer to this style of editing as image optimization. It’s not changing anything, just putting the finishing touches on.

Below you’ll see the same image right out of camera as well as the optimized version. You’ll notice that the exposure hasn’t changed all that much, though the optimized image is a tad brighter. This was achieved by shooting in a RAW file format and moving the exposure slider a tad to the right as well as some classic dodging in photoshop. The most notable difference outside of brightness is the removal of some dust spots. Let’s take a closer look.

Give It a Shot

Any image exposed to the right will need some form of touching up, either to tone back some highlights or bring some shadows back down to their proper values. The resulting image though, will be cleaner, offering greater detail and less noise than one shot to the right. If you want to see the difference for yourself, take two photos, one normally, and the other to the right and see if you can make out a difference.

Camera manufacturers are constantly updating their auto exposure algorithms and the dynamic range of their cameras. Recovering shadows and blown highlights is easier than it’s ever been, making this practice less and less common. In fact, for slightly underexposed images, we say go ahead and increase your exposure a bit. That said, for larger discrepancies, the impact to image quality with be more significant.

Look back at the header image when you’re done. Notice how even in the darker parts of the image, namely under the wings, there’s still ample detail. The final result isn’t necessarily bright, but that’s only because it was exposed to the right and then optimized.

If capturing the best image quality possible is your goal, then it’s important to get as much right in camera as we can.
